Description:
Learn advanced CSS techniques for creating full-width elements on one side of a container in this comprehensive 29-minute tutorial. Explore versatile methods for breaking out of container constraints while diving deep into custom properties, logical properties, grid systems, and positioning. Master the art of responsive design by implementing different layouts for small and large screens, fixing content placement, and adjusting background widths. Discover solutions for various scenarios, including text placement before images, and learn how to fine-tune vertical spacing, alignment, and inner spacing. Enhance your CSS skills with practical examples and expert tips for creating visually appealing and flexible layouts.
